hi,
i bought a laptop from a UK-based company, meshcomputers. im located in UK too, yet... this laptop does not play my Region B (uk) blu-rays. "This movie is coded to Region B region, and will not play on this drive" something like that pops up. how can i fix it? pointless me having a blu-ray drive if it doesnt play any of my movies... |

i found an option in my software 'acer arcade' that allowed me to change it to region B.
gave me only 5 attempts and now ive used one. but so far, everything.... (the ones ive tried) all work. |

Yeah - you need to set the region code initially - and on some drives / software that even means doing this in device mangler. Probably a matter of time before the region-free firmware hacks start appearing - but in the meantime, stick with your region...
